A flowing pet bowl combination comprising: base 1, water tank 3 is provided with delivery port 31 on the water tank 3, presses subassembly 4 to include: a pressing member 48, the pressing member 48 being connected to the outside of the water tank 3, the pressing member being provided with a first connecting member 49; the baffle 44 is shielded at the water outlet 31, the baffle 44 is provided with a connecting piece 42 connected with the rod body 41, the rod body 41 is provided with a second rotating shaft 40, the second rotating shaft 40 is connected in the water tank 3, one end of the rod body 41 is provided with a first telescopic piece 43, one end of the first telescopic piece 43 is connected on the water tank 3, and the baffle 44 is lifted by a pressing piece 48 so that the shielded water outlet 31 is opened.
A base 1, with reference to figures 1-2 of the specification; the base 1 is provided with a water injection disc 12, an accommodating disc 2, a floor sucking disc 11, a water tank 3 and a bracket 23; the bottom of the base 1 is provided with a ground suction disc 11, and the ground suction disc 11 is used for fixing the movement of the base 1 in use. The water injection tray 12 is arranged above the base 1 and is used for receiving water flowing out of the water tank 3; the accommodating disc 2 is arranged on one side of the water injection disc 12, pet food is placed in the accommodating disc, a first rotating shaft 22 is further arranged on the accommodating disc 2, one surface of the first rotating shaft 22 is connected to the accommodating disc 2, and the other surface of the first rotating shaft is connected to the support 23; support 23 is on base 1 and has the interval with base 1, makes holding dish 2 be changeed on support 23 through first pivot 22, it is required to explain that support 23 is the semicircle arc shape, and can place water tank 3 above the support 23 for holding dish 2 is changeed below water tank 3 through raising the pivot, so that the pet grain that has not eaten up is sheltered from below water tank 3, prevents the pollution of pet grain. It should be noted that the handle member 21 is disposed on the accommodating tray 2 to facilitate pushing the accommodating tray 2 to the lower side of the water tank 3. Wherein, the water tank 3 on the support 23, the water tank 3 is provided with a water outlet 31, the water outlet 31 is provided with a diversion trench 32, and the water injection tray 12 is arranged below the diversion trench 32, specifically, the water in the water tank 3 flows out from the water outlet 31 and flows into the water injection tray 12 along the diversion trench 32.
A pressing assembly 4, see figures 2-3 of the specification; the pressing assembly 4 is disposed on the water tank 3, and the pressing assembly 4 includes: the pressing piece 48, the first telescopic piece 43, the first connecting piece 49, the second telescopic piece 45, the baffle 44, the first rotating shaft 22, the rod body 41 and the connecting piece 42; the pressing piece 48 is arranged outside the water tank 3, the second rotating shaft 40 is arranged on the pressing piece 48, and the second rotating shaft 40 is connected to the water tank 3, so that the pressing piece 48 can be turned over on the water tank 3 up and down; first pivot 22 sets up in water tank 3 and first pivot 22 and body of rod 41 are connected for body of rod 41 can the up-and-down motion in water tank 3, is connected with first telescopic link on the body of rod 41, and the one end of first telescopic link is connected on water tank 3, and the other end is connected on body of rod 41, and through pressing down of pressing member 48 make first extensible member 43 stretch out and draw back on body of rod 41. The other end of the rod body 41 is connected with a connecting rod, one end of the connecting rod is connected with a baffle 44, a second telescopic piece 45 is further arranged on the baffle 44, and one or more groups of telescopic pieces are arranged, so that the baffle 44 is relatively fixed on the water outlet 31. Specifically, the pressing member 48 presses downward, so that the first telescopic member 43 is elongated to increase the weight on the side opposite to the rod 41, so that the baffle 44 on the side opposite to the rod 41 is lifted upward, so that the blocked water outlet 31 can flow out. It should be noted that a vacant position is provided on the shutter 44, and the shutter 44 moves upward to make the vacant position contact the water outlet 31, so that the water in the water tank 3 is discharged.
The working principle is as follows:
the pressing piece 48 on the water tank 3 is pressed, so that the rod body 41 moves downwards towards the pressing piece 48, the connecting piece 42 on the baffle plate 44 moves upwards, the second telescopic piece 45 on the baffle plate 44 is further pulled upwards, the baffle plate 44 moves upwards, the water outlet 31 blocked by the baffle plate 44 is opened, and the water in the water tank 3 flows out of the water outlet 31.
